Linda Boff

Boff is responsible for GE’s global advertising and digital marketing along with the company’s brand and design strategy.
Previously, Boff was CMO of iVillage Properties, part of the NBC Universal. Boff joined GE in early 2004 with 18 years of experience in marketing, advertising and communications including senior roles at Citigroup, the American Museum of Natural History and Porter Novelli.
Boff was named B2B Magazine’s 2012 Digital Marketer of Year. She is a frequent speaker at digital and social media industry events.
Boff earned a BA in Political Science and Psychology from Union College. She lives in Irvington, NY with her husband and two children.
